Using my ISP's internet. livery downloads will randomly get stuck on "Downloading livery" with no apparent download progress being made.
When I enable a VPN, I used Cloudflare WARP via WireGuard, the downloads behave as expected with no issues.
To reproduce
Install one or more liveries on an affected connection.
Environment
Manager version: 0.4.1
FS2020 Version: n/a
ISP: Vodafone Germany, DS-Lite, using IPv4 only. ISP has commonly known reliability issues.
Screenshots or videos
Click to expand
![Liveries_Mega_Pack_Manager_2021-01-14_12-12-18](https://user-images.githubusercontent.com/29005772/104592782-04fd4d80-566f-11eb-8cdd-48c2b7956e91.png)
Side note:
I am seeing a similar issue when using the package manager Chocolatey, though no significant packet loss seems to be present, it will randomly stall when listing or downloading packages. Using a VPN is the solution here as well. However, these are the only examples of this I know of, all other services or websites I use work fine.
Suggested action:
I don't know where the issue lies exactly, if it is the application or even the CDN used. The implementation of a mechanism to detect stalled downloads to retry or fail them would go a long way to improve the downloading experience.
Description
Using my ISP's internet. livery downloads will randomly get stuck on "Downloading livery" with no apparent download progress being made.
When I enable a VPN, I used Cloudflare WARP via WireGuard, the downloads behave as expected with no issues.
To reproduce
Install one or more liveries on an affected connection.
Environment
Manager version: 0.4.1
FS2020 Version: n/a
ISP: Vodafone Germany, DS-Lite, using IPv4 only. ISP has commonly known reliability issues.
Screenshots or videos
Click to expand
![Liveries_Mega_Pack_Manager_2021-01-14_12-12-18](https://user-images.githubusercontent.com/29005772/104592782-04fd4d80-566f-11eb-8cdd-48c2b7956e91.png)Side note:
I am seeing a similar issue when using the package manager Chocolatey, though no significant packet loss seems to be present, it will randomly stall when listing or downloading packages. Using a VPN is the solution here as well. However, these are the only examples of this I know of, all other services or websites I use work fine.
Suggested action:
I don't know where the issue lies exactly, if it is the application or even the CDN used. The implementation of a mechanism to detect stalled downloads to retry or fail them would go a long way to improve the downloading experience.